**Vendor note: Inkmill markdown pipeline**

Rendering for Parchway docs is outsourced to Inkmill under an annual contract, renewing each March. They handle sanitization and PDF export; we own the upload queue. SLA: 4-hour response on rendering failures. Escalate only after two failed retries. Their support desk is reachable at the address below.

billing contact of hahaf-baguf = zorael.tammir.jorius@sivrelhq.internal

Re: `tailwisp` CLI — the follow mode polls too fast when the Marlowe aggregator is cold, and we've seen it hammer the index service during restarts. I added jittered backoff and a hard cap on buffered lines so OOMs stop happening on the Pellworth boxes. Future maintainers: don't tune these ad hoc in prod; change them here and ship. The defaults now live in one place, shown below.

tuning table, faduf-baduf:
PRIORITIES = {
    "ulavan": 191,
    "silys": 750,
    "goriel": 238,
    "kelmir": 66,
    "wendor": 432,
}

During fire drills at the Ashcote Building, reception staff must bring the visitor sign-in tablet to the assembly point on Fenwright Green and read the roll call aloud. Any visitor unaccounted for must be reported to the drill marshal immediately. Visitors may not re-enter until the all-clear. To retrieve the backup paper register from the marshal's cabinet by the east door, use the access code below.

staff pass of kawip-hawef = bdg-QLP-2

Subject: Velmora plant — time to decide

Team,

Quick one before Thursday's board session. The Velmora facility is running at 94% capacity, and the Ostrev line can't absorb overflow past Q2. Options are a second shift at Velmora or fast-tracking the Brindale expansion. Marek's team costed both; the gap is smaller than we expected. I'd like us aligned before we present. The confidential summary of where I'm leaning follows below.

board note of bawep-tajef: Queniusek Systems plans to raise the Quenvan list price by 53.1 percent in March. The pricing group signed off on a budget of $176.4 million for Project Drueth. The renewal with Casionix Partners closes at $142.5 million a year, 8.3 percent below the last contract. Project Fraax slips by six weeks because of the tooling delay.